推广 热搜: 教师  系统  蒸汽  经纪  参数    行业  机械    设备 

比特币挖矿的过程是怎样的?

   日期:2024-04-19     移动:http://www.cs-ej.cn/mobile/quote/4315.html

比特币挖矿是指利用计算机进行复杂的数学运算,以解锁新的比特币并验证交易的过程。挖矿是比特币网络的重要组成部分,也是保持网络安全和稳定的核心机制。本文将介绍比特币挖矿的过程,并深入探讨挖矿的原理和技术细节。

在比特币网络中,挖矿是通过解决一个数学难题来竞争生成新的区块的过程。这个数学难题称为工作量证明(Proof of Work),其目的是确保每个区块都经过了一定的计算量和时间来生成,从而防止恶意用户篡改交易记录。

比特币挖矿的过程是怎样的?_https://www.huzhuti.com_币圈资讯_第1张

挖矿的过程是将待处理的交易打包成一个区块,然后通过不断尝试不同的随机数来计算出一个满足特定条件的哈希值。只有当计算得到的哈希值小于目标值时,这个新区块才能被添加到区块链上。

比特币挖矿的技术细节包括哈希函数、区块头、难度目标等关键概念。哈希函数是一种将任意长度的数据映射为固定长度哈希值的算法,比特币网络使用SHA-256哈希函数来计算区块的哈希值。

区块头是由区块的交易信息和前一个区块的哈希值组成的数据结构,挖矿的目标就是找到一个符合难度目标的区块头哈希值。难度目标是一个数字,表示哈希值必须小于该数字才能成功挖出新区块。

在比特币网络中,挖矿的竞争非常激烈,每个矿工都在不断尝试计算出符合难度目标的哈希值。由于哈希函数的性质,只有不断尝试新的随机数才可能找到符合条件的哈希值,这就导致了挖矿的随机性和不可预测性。

挖矿的奖励是新发行的比特币和交易手续费,矿工成功挖出新区块后会获得这些奖励。由于挖矿奖励的存在,矿工之间存在激烈的竞争,通常只有最先解出难题的矿工才能获得奖励。

比特币挖矿需要大量的计算能力和电力支持,这导致了挖矿对环境的不利影响。矿工通常会购买大量的专用硬件设备来提高挖矿效率,这些设备消耗大量电力,导致了能源浪费和碳排放。

为了减少挖矿对环境的影响,一些矿工开始使用可再生能源来供电,或者选择在低成本电力的地区挖矿。比特币网络也在不断优化挖矿的算法,以降低挖矿的能耗和碳排放。

比特币挖矿是一项复杂而重要的过程,它不仅支持比特币网络的正常运行,还促进了区块链技术的发展。随着比特币网络的不断演进和改进,挖矿的方式和机制也在不断优化,为未来的数字货币世界铺平道路。希望本文对比特币挖矿有所帮助,谢谢阅读!

本文地址:http://www.cs-ej.cn/quote/4315.html    成事e家 http://www.cs-ej.cn/ , 查看更多

特别提示:本信息由相关企业自行提供,真实性未证实,仅供参考。请谨慎采用,风险自负。


相关行业动态
推荐行业动态
点击排行
网站首页  |  关于我们  |  联系方式  |  使用协议  |  版权隐私  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报  |  鄂ICP备2020018471号